Bridging the Gender Gap in ADHD Diagnosis: A Call to Action for Clinicians

For decades, ADHD has been understood and diagnosed primarily through a male-centric lens. This systemic bias has led to a crisis of underdiagnosis, missed and misdiagnoses among girls and women, leaving many without the support they need.
